I picked up a boat today with a 20" transom, but it has a 15" motor hanging on it. Does anyone know if a 15" Mercury 500 can be converted to a 20" shaft length?
I'm doing a motor swap anyhow, but would have more uses for this motor if it were 20". Even my smaller aluminum boats have 20" transoms.
